文本挖掘毕设题目及答案.docxVIP

文本挖掘毕设题目及答案.docx

本文档由用户AI专业辅助创建,并经网站质量审核通过
  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

文本挖掘毕设题目及答案

摘要

本文围绕文本挖掘相关的毕业设计题目展开探讨,旨在为即将进行文本挖掘方向毕业设计的学生提供全面的参考。文中不仅列举了多个不同难度和侧重点的文本挖掘毕设题目,还针对每个题目给出了详细的解答思路、技术方案以及可能遇到的问题和解决办法,涵盖了文本分类、情感分析、信息抽取等多个文本挖掘的重要领域。

一、引言

文本挖掘是数据挖掘的一个重要分支,它致力于从大量的文本数据中发现有价值的信息和知识。随着互联网的飞速发展,文本数据呈现出爆炸式增长,文本挖掘的应用也越来越广泛,如搜索引擎优化、舆情分析、智能客服等。对于计算机科学、信息管理等相关专业的学生来说,选择文本挖掘作为毕业设计题目,不仅能够锻炼自己的编程能力和数据分析能力,还能深入了解该领域的前沿技术和应用场景。

二、文本挖掘毕设题目及答案

(一)基于深度学习的新闻文本分类系统设计与实现

1.题目背景

新闻媒体每天都会产生大量的新闻文本,对这些新闻进行分类有助于信息的快速检索和管理。传统的文本分类方法在处理大规模、复杂的新闻数据时效果往往不佳,而深度学习在自然语言处理领域展现出了强大的能力,能够自动提取文本的特征,提高分类的准确性。

2.解答思路

-数据收集与预处理:从各大新闻网站或新闻数据库中收集新闻文本数据,并进行清洗、分词、去除停用词等预处理操作。

-模型选择与训练:选择合适的深度学习模型,如卷积神经网络(CNN)、循环神经网络(RNN)及其变体(如LSTM、GRU)等,对预处理后的数据进行训练。

-系统实现与评估:使用Python和相关的深度学习框架(如TensorFlow、PyTorch)实现新闻文本分类系统,并使用测试数据集对系统的性能进行评估。

3.技术方案

-数据预处理:使用Python的`jieba`库进行中文分词,使用`sklearn`库中的`TfidfVectorizer`将文本转换为向量表示。

-模型构建:使用Keras或PyTorch构建深度学习模型,例如使用Keras构建一个简单的CNN模型:

```python

fromkeras.modelsimportSequential

fromkeras.layersimportConv1D,GlobalMaxPooling1D,Dense,Embedding

model=Sequential()

model.add(Embedding(input_dim=vocab_size,output_dim=embedding_dim,input_length=max_length))

model.add(Conv1D(filters=128,kernel_size=5,activation=relu))

model.add(GlobalMaxPooling1D())

model.add(Dense(10,activation=softmax))

pile(optimizer=adam,loss=categorical_crossentropy,metrics=[accuracy])

```

-模型训练与评估:使用训练数据集对模型进行训练,并使用测试数据集进行评估。

4.可能遇到的问题及解决办法

-数据不平衡问题:在新闻数据集中,不同类别的新闻数量可能存在较大差异,导致模型对数量较少的类别分类效果不佳。可以采用过采样、欠采样或加权损失函数等方法来解决。

-模型过拟合问题:深度学习模型容易出现过拟合现象,可以通过增加训练数据、使用正则化方法(如L1、L2正则化)、早停策略等方法来缓解。

(二)社交媒体文本情感分析系统的研究与开发

1.题目背景

社交媒体已经成为人们表达观点和情感的重要平台,对社交媒体文本进行情感分析有助于企业了解用户的满意度和市场趋势,政府了解公众的情绪和意见。

2.解答思路

-数据收集与标注:从社交媒体平台(如微博、Twitter等)收集文本数据,并对其进行情感标注(如积极、消极、中性)。

-特征提取与模型选择:提取文本的特征,如词向量、情感词典特征等,选择合适的分类模型(如朴素贝叶斯、支持向量机、深度学习模型等)进行情感分类。

-系统实现与优化:使用Python和相关的机器学习库实现情感分析系统,并对系统进行优化,提高分类的准确性。

3.技术方案

-数据收集与标注:使用社交媒体的API(如微博API、TwitterAPI)收集文本数据,并使用人工标注或半监督学习的方法进行情感标注。

-特征提取:使用预训练的词向量模型(如Word2Vec、GloVe)将文本转换为向量表示,同时结合情感词典提取情感特征。

-模型构建:使用`sklearn`库中的`MultinomialNB`(朴素贝叶斯)和`SVC`(支持

您可能关注的文档

文档评论(0)

153****5842 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档